Brent Sowal, a homesteader at his family’s Hidden Hollow Farm in Berks County, has found solace in his hands-on pursuits. In his free time, he tends to his bees, crafts cutting boards from fallen trees, builds fences, nurtures a small orchard, and cultivates mushrooms. He credits these activities with helping him unwind and reconnect with nature.

“Working with my hands in different ways grounds me,” he explains. “It’s a way to calm my mind and focus on the present.” For Sarah Sowal, “another aspect of self-care involves exploring her creative side through photography and travel.” She believes that traveling has broadened her perspective and provided a unique opportunity to appreciate the world’s vastness. “Experiencing the vastness of the world has helped me deprioritize the things that often consume my thoughts,” she reflects.
